The City of Port Coquitlam is inviting children and youth to participate in the cherished tradition of May Days by joining the Royal Party or performing in school Maypole dances. Applications are open, but the deadline to apply is fast approaching—January 12, 2025.
Children in Grades 1 through 5 can apply to be part of this year’s Royal Party, selected through a random draw. Flower Girls and Junior Lancers are chosen from Grades 1 and 2, while Princesses and Lancers are selected from Grades 4 and 5.
Applications for the Royal Party are being accepted online at portcoquitlam.ca/maydays until January 12, 2025.
Royal party members will participate in:
- Hip hop dance practices: Wednesdays and Fridays beginning February 5 until May 2 at the Port Coquitlam Community Centre (PCCC). No practices during spring break.
- Flower girls and Junior Lancers will practice from 4:00 to 4:40 p.m.
- Princesses and Lancers from 4:45 to 5:30 p.m.
- Royal Party Selection Luncheon: March 9 from 11:30 a.m. to 1:30 p.m.
- Opening Ceremony Rehearsal: May 4 from 10:30 a.m. to 12:30 p.m.
- May Day Opening Ceremony performances: May 4 from 3:00 to 4:30 p.m.
- Rotary May Day Parade – May 10 from 10:30 a.m. to 1 p.m.
School Maypole Dances
Elementary schools in Port Coquitlam will be performing the Maypole dances during the May Days opening ceremony on Sunday May 4, 2025. Students in grades 3 to 5 who live in Port Coquitlam are encouraged to join their school’s maypole team. Maypole practices will be coordintated by the schools. About May Days
The tradition of May Day royalty in Port Coquitlam began in 1923 with the crowning of the first May Queen.
Over the years, May Days has grown into a week-long festival celebrating spring with the Rotary May Day Parade, outdoor activities, and a variety of artistic performances and displays.
This year’s May Days festival will take place from May 4 to 10, 2025, with additional event details to be announced closer to the date.
